Overview of the Products
The Eeghurt Automatic 360 Sonic Toothbrush is priced at $20.86, making it a budget-friendly option compared to the Wagner Stern Ultrasonic Whitening Toothbrush, which retails for $39.95. This price difference of about 48% suggests that the Eeghurt model is significantly more accessible for consumers looking for an efficient oral care solution without breaking the bank. Both products cater to those seeking advanced dental hygiene alternatives, but their features and functionalities vary greatly.
Design and Build Quality
The Eeghurt Automatic 360 Sonic Toothbrush features a unique U-shape design, tailored to fit the natural curvature of teeth. This design allows for a comprehensive cleaning experience, completing a 360° brushing action in just 45 seconds. In contrast, the Wagner Stern Ultrasonic Whitening Toothbrush emphasizes ergonomic design with a pressure sensor and comes packaged with eight soft bristles for a gentler brushing experience. While the design of the Eeghurt toothbrush promotes efficiency, the Wagner Stern model focuses on user comfort and protection against gum damage.
Cleaning Modes and Performance
The Eeghurt toothbrush offers three distinct modes: strong, massage, and whitening, allowing users to switch between functionalities easily. This multifunctionality is ideal for users focused on both cleaning and gum care. The Wagner Stern toothbrush, on the other hand, boasts five brushing modes and four levels of intensity, providing a more customizable experience. With its 48,000 VPM levitating motor, it promises a deep clean that can remove up to ten times more plaque than a manual toothbrush. This level of performance may appeal to those who prioritize thorough cleaning.
Charging and Battery Life
The Eeghurt Automatic 360 Sonic Toothbrush features wireless charging, requiring only three hours to fully charge and lasting for about a week. This convenience makes it suitable for both home use and travel. In comparison, the Wagner Stern toothbrush offers an impressive battery life that lasts up to 30 days on a single charge, thanks to its advanced Lithium-Ion battery. This extended battery life is particularly beneficial for frequent travelers or those who prefer minimal maintenance.
Maintenance and Usability
The Eeghurt model emphasizes easy cleaning and maintenance, as it is made from food-grade eco-friendly silica gel and is IPX7 waterproof. This feature allows users to clean the toothbrush thoroughly without worrying about damage. The Wagner Stern toothbrush also incorporates user-friendly elements, such as a smart timer that prompts users to switch quadrants every 30 seconds, ensuring thorough cleaning. Both models prioritize ease of use, but the Wagner Stern's additional features may make it more appealing for those who prefer a guided brushing experience.
